Three including BSF man hurt in Kuki militants' firing
Sugnu, Pukhao Shantipur under attack
Source: The Sangai Express
Imphal, February 15 2024:
At least two village defenders and one BSF personnel sustained injuries as Kuki militants attacked Sugnu and Pukhao Shantipur yet again.
Reportedly, the situation at both Sugnu and Pukhao-Shantipur is still tense.
The injured village volunteers have been identified as Ningombam Rakesh (28), s/o Hemanta of Pukhao Khabam Mayai Leikai and Kshetrimayum Rakesh (40), s/o Late Juge of Kongpal Kshetri Leikai while the injured BSF personnel is Constable Anurag Ahuja (34), s/o Umapati Ahuja of Uttar Pradesh.
While Ksh Rakesh was hit by a sniper on his chest last night at Sugnu and the bullet hasn't been removed as of yet, the other village defender N Rakesh sustained bullet injuries on his leg at Pukhao-Shantipur.
The BSF Constable, on the other hand, got injured on his right abdomen in the attack at Sugnu Higher Secondary School where personnel of BSF 136 Battalion D Coy are stationed.
Both the village volunteers are undergoing treatment at Raj Medicity and they are stable, said a credible source.
Reportedly, Kuki militants carried out the heavy attack at Sugnu for the second consecutive day from Lailoiphai and Dongyang villages in Churachandpur district, during which the BSF personnel got injured.
It is further reported that the Kuki militants also fired 81 inch mortar shells in the attack at Sugnu.
Sugnu has been under the attack of Kuki militants since yesterday and gunfight is still underway in the area with regular intervals.
Kuki militants resumed their offensive at Sugnu Awang Leikai Thongmanak and Sugnu Higher Secondary School at around 2 am with dozens of bombs accompanied by heavy firing using sophisticated weapons.
Some properties were destroyed at Sugnu Awang Leikai Thongmanak and one bomb suspected to be an 81 inch mortar shell exploded in the courtyard of one Moirangthem Radhamohan.
The gunfight was going on at the time this report was filed with regular intervals.
There is no report of any injury on the side of village volunteers at Sugnu in today's firefight.
Speaking to the media, a local of Sugnu wondered how 81 inch mortar shells 'which are issued only to security forces' were fired from the side of Kuki militants.
Tension is still high at Sungu.
Meanwhile, the attack at Pukhao Shantipur was launched from the nearby hill range in the morning today.
Apart from firing, the Kuki militants also carried out a bomb attack, leaving one village volunteer injured.
The exchange of fire which took place in the periphery of Imphal East and Kangpokpi district lasted some hours.
Tight securing measures have been taken up in the area and there is no report of any firing from Kuki militants after the gunfight in the morning stopped.
The situation, however, is still tense in the area.
